Understanding the Moro Spin Design
At the heart of the moro spin’s success lies its carefully engineered design. Unlike traditional spinnerbaits, the moro spin boasts a unique blade arrangement that creates a more subtle and natural vibration. The blades aren’t simply attached to a central wire; they’re strategically positioned and angled to induce a lifelike fluttering motion as the lure is retrieved. This nuanced action is key to attracting fish, as it closely resembles the movements of injured baitfish or fleeing prey. The shape of the blades themselves is also critical, often featuring a willow leaf or Colorado design, or combinations of both, to alter the flash and vibration characteristics. The wire gauge and bend impart unique action, determining the overall profile and responsiveness of the lure.
Blade Materials and Their Impact
The materials used in the construction of the moro spin blades also play a significant role in its performance. High-quality stainless steel is the most common choice, providing excellent durability and corrosion resistance. However, some manufacturers are experimenting with alternative materials, such as brass or even specialized alloys, to fine-tune the blade’s weight, flash, and resistance to bending. Heavier blades create a more pronounced vibration, ideal for murky water or targeting larger fish. Lighter blades, on the other hand, offer a subtler presentation, better suited for clear water or finicky fish. The color of the blade – gold, silver, or painted finishes – add visual attraction and mimic various prey species.

Optimal Retrieval Techniques for Moro Spins
The moro spin isn’t simply a cast-and-retrieve lure. Successfully utilizing it requires experimentation with different retrieval techniques to determine what triggers a reaction from the fish. A steady, medium-paced retrieve is a good starting point, allowing the blades to rotate freely and create their characteristic flash and vibration. Varying the speed and incorporating pauses can also be highly effective, particularly in colder water or when fish are less active. The rod tip position during the retrieve is also vital; maintaining a slight upward angle helps keep the lure tracking straight and prevents it from snagging on underwater obstructions. Adjustments needs to be made dependent on current, depth and structure present.
Incorporating Jerk and Stop-and-Go Retrieves
To further enhance the lure’s action, consider incorporating jerk and stop-and-go retrieves. A quick jerk of the rod tip imparts a sudden burst of movement, mimicking an injured baitfish struggling to escape. Following the jerk with a pause allows the lure to flutter downwards, creating a vulnerable presentation. This technique is particularly effective around structure, such as docks, weed beds, and submerged timber. The stop-and-go retrieve involves alternating between periods of steady retrieve and brief pauses, creating an erratic action that can entice hesitant fish to strike. Experimenting with the length of the pauses and the intensity of the jerks is critical to discovering what works best in a given situation.

Matching Moro Spins to Different Fishing Environments
The versatility of the moro spin extends to its adaptability to a wide range of fishing environments. In clear water, where fish are easily spooked, a slower retrieve and smaller blades are preferred. These minimize flash and vibration, creating a more subtle presentation that is less likely to alert wary fish. In murky water, however, a faster retrieve and larger blades are more effective. The increased flash and vibration help fish locate the lure, even in low-visibility conditions. When fishing around heavy cover, such as thick weed beds or fallen trees, a heavier moro spin with a weed guard is essential to prevent snagging. Varying the weight of the lure allows it to target different depths effectively.
Adapting to Different Fish Species
Different fish species also respond differently to the moro spin. Bass, for example, are often attracted to fast-moving lures with a lot of flash, while walleye tend to prefer a slower, more subtle presentation. Pike and muskie, being predatory fish, are often drawn to larger moro spins with aggressive retrieves. Understanding the feeding habits and preferences of the target species is crucial to selecting the right color, size, and weight of the lure. For example, when targeting largemouth bass in stained water, a chartreuse-and-white moro spin is often an excellent choice, while for smallmouth bass in clear water, a natural-colored lure with silver blades may be more effective.

Color Selection and Its Impact on Strike Rates
Color plays a surprising, yet significant, role in influencing a fish’s decision to strike. The choice of color should be based on several factors, including water clarity, weather conditions, and the type of forage present in the environment. In clear water, natural colors that mimic the local baitfish are generally the most effective. These include silver, white, and various shades of green and brown. In murky water, brighter colors, such as chartreuse, orange, and red, can help fish locate the lure more easily. On overcast days, darker colors may be more effective, while on sunny days, brighter colors can create more contrast and attract attention. Understanding how light impacts color visibility underwater is critical.
The specific type of forage present in the environment should also guide color selection. If shad are abundant, a silver or white moro spin is a good choice. If bluegill are prevalent, a green or brown lure may be more effective. Matching the hatch – selecting a lure color that closely resembles the local forage – is a proven technique for increasing strike rates. Furthermore, experimenting with different color combinations can reveal unexpected preferences from fish in a particular location.
Beyond the Basics: Customizing Your Moro Spin Presentation
While the moro spin is highly effective straight out of the box, anglers can further enhance its performance through customization. This includes changing the skirt color and material, experimenting with different blade combinations, and adding attractants such as scent or rattles. Adding a trailer hook can also significantly improve hook-up rates, particularly on short strikes. For example, a plastic grub or swimbait trailer can add bulk and action to the lure, making it more visible and enticing to fish. Adjusting the weight of the lure allows it to be fished at different depths, adapting to varying underwater structures.
Beyond physical modifications, anglers can also customize their presentation by utilizing different line types and leader materials. Fluorocarbon line is virtually invisible underwater, making it an excellent choice for clear water situations. Monofilament line offers good stretch and buoyancy, while braided line provides superior sensitivity and strength. The use of a fluorocarbon leader can help reduce line visibility in clear water, while a wire leader can prevent bite-offs from toothy fish like pike and muskie. These subtle adjustments can make a profound difference in the number of fish landed.
